Freshbits โ€” spring cleaning + a couple of sharp fixes


Fixes

- 25e89cc86 fix(security): harden shell env fallback
- f9108120c fix(gateway): strip inline directive tags from displayed text
- #22825 00b98a368 fix: flatten nested anyOf/oneOf in Gemini schema cleaning
- 549549f6a fix(ci): sync plugin versions and harden install smoke
- 48ddb1cc8 fix(ci): stabilize install smoke in docker

Refactors / Chore

- 22940b7b9 refactor(discord): split allowlist resolution flow
- 4540790cb refactor(bluebubbles): share dm/group access policy checks
- 7724abeee refactor(test): dedupe env setup across suites (lots of follow-up cleanup)

Docs

- c3af00bdd docs(changelog): split 2026.2.21 release entries
- #22890 ac633366c docs: add Onur Solmaz to contributors
Was this page helpful?